Agreed but I thought Canelo was going to win because he would be able to get in on Bivol and get to his body and wear him down and finish him late. I could not have been more wrong. Canelo landed a couple body shots but most were blocked or simply missed as Bivol simply didnt allow it with movement that kept him off the ropes most of the fight. He kept Canelo on the end of the jab and it was a wrap. I think if he had pushed the attack over the last 3 rounds he couldve gotten the stoppage. Canelo needs to go back and stay at 168 or if he stays at 175 he should take a couple lesser fights to get acclimated to the weight and then look for a rematch.
